## Deployment — Pylontide Relay

Pylontide terminates websockets at the edge. Compression is the main knob: per-message deflate cuts egress roughly 60% on chatty JSON streams but costs CPU and adds memory per connection due to context takeover. For fleets over 10k concurrent sockets, disable takeover or cap window bits. Review any change against the Harbrook load profile before merging. Deploys are blue-green; config ships with the image, so a bad setting means a full rollback. The shipped defaults are as follows.

settings of fafog-yajof:
ulaael:
  log_level: warn
  metrics_host: metrics.ulaael.zemvarlabs.internal
  pin: 7979
  pool_size: 32

Ticket: Staging env misconfigured for Siftgate bloom filter

The bloom layer in front of the Pellet KV store is rejecting all lookups in staging because the env file was copied from the dev template without credentials. False-positive tuning values are fine; only the auth line is missing. To unblock the weekly demo, the Pellet admission secret must be set on the following line.

env line for yaguf-fajop: LEDGER_TOKEN13=fb08984397349

Subject: Handover — RateLens release duties

Hi Orla,

Handing over RateLens, our hotel rate-parity checker, for the week. The scraper pool redeploys nightly; watch the Calvert staging dashboard for parity-drift alerts before promoting. Release 4.2 is queued and fully tested. To push it, you'll need to sign the bundle with the deploy key below.

rollout seal: bky3_bf1

### Account Recovery — Catalogue Import (Lintwood)

Quick one for review: when the Lintwood catalogue import wipes a patron's session table, the recovery flow re-seeds accounts from the nightly snapshot. Check that the importer skips locked accounts — last time it didn't. To rerun recovery against staging you'll need the vault passphrase, which is appended just below.

recovery phrase for yafof-tajof: julmir-kelax-julvan-holath-belvan-holir-ralael-ralvan-ralath-julvan-silmir-istmir-kaswyn-ulamir